Suspension: progressive lowerering shocks,D&D girder
Paint/Body: tank and fender by joker and jugs painting,frame powdercoated
Interior/Electronics: twin tek electronic single fire ignition
Wheels/Tires: 40 spoke front with 21" avon venom,40 spoke rear with 16 " donlop
Engine: 1000 cc ironhead,20 over,port and polished,karata belt primary

About my XLCH Sportster

bought in 06 as a total basket case, no tranny, engine cases cracked,basicly all that was usable was frame and girder front end,built it over the course of the next two years,got it mostly completed by midsummer last year and won in two bike shows.finihed itup over the winter and it's finally complete
